+// This test verifies that wallet settings can be added and removed
+// concurrently, ensuring no race conditions occur during either process.
+BOOST_FIXTURE_TEST_CASE(write_wallet_settings_concurrently, TestingSetup)
+{
+ auto chain = m_node.chain.get();
+ const auto NUM_WALLETS{5};
+
+ // Since we're counting the number of wallets, ensure we start without any.
+ BOOST_REQUIRE(chain->getRwSetting("wallet").isNull());
+
+ const auto& check_concurrent_wallet = [&](const auto& settings_function, int num_expected_wallets) {
+ std::vector<std::thread> threads;
+ threads.reserve(NUM_WALLETS);
+ for (auto i{0}; i < NUM_WALLETS; ++i) threads.emplace_back(settings_function, i);
+ for (auto& t : threads) t.join();
+
+ auto wallets = chain->getRwSetting("wallet");
+ BOOST_CHECK_EQUAL(wallets.getValues().size(), num_expected_wallets);
+ };
+
+ // Add NUM_WALLETS wallets concurrently, ensure we end up with NUM_WALLETS stored.
+ check_concurrent_wallet([&chain](int i) {
+ Assert(AddWalletSetting(*chain, strprintf("wallet_%d", i)));
+ },
+ /*num_expected_wallets=*/NUM_WALLETS);
+
+ // Remove NUM_WALLETS wallets concurrently, ensure we end up with 0 wallets.
+ check_concurrent_wallet([&chain](int i) {
+ Assert(RemoveWalletSetting(*chain, strprintf("wallet_%d", i)));
+ },
+ /*num_expected_wallets=*/0);
+}
